mini2440这块arm开发板怎样才算最好利用

我有一块mini2440的arm开发板。移植了Linux系统后感觉很好玩,但是对自己来说只是停留在欣赏的阶段。我觉得对自己来说还是得先以硬件为主。搞懂这块板子的电路图,各个实验的原理。
有没有必要学习Linux内核呢?然后了解它各个模块的功能,然后根据自己需要完成的实验目的来剪裁内核?
希望各位真在使用arm开发板的朋友们给点好的建议。怎样利用好手中的开发板。如果你们要是在网上有什么学习笔记。麻烦贴一下你的网址。谢谢!

学习是一个循序渐进的过程。

我刚开始学的时候也是想“高大全”,什么都想学,从底层到应用都想学,后来发现这个是错误的思想。

软件规模在今天已经非常庞大,一个人不可能什么都学会,因此对自己在学习上有一个合理定位是很重要的。

你可以问问自己的兴趣在什么地方。

如果你对硬件寄存器、操作时序以及配套的底层软件感兴趣,恭喜你,你可以先学习关于驱动程序的编写,等到深入之后,你会自然而然的开始学习Linux内核以及各个模块的功能,因为这时非学不可了,你会成为一名优秀的Linux驱动工程师;

如果你对编写算法感兴趣,而对于底层的各种接口函数如何实现并没有多少兴趣,那么恭喜你,你可以尝试编写关于Linux的应用程序,例如图像处理、UI界面、基于Linux的媒体播放器等等,你会成为一名优秀的嵌入式应用软件工程师;

如果你只对硬件感兴趣,想尝试设计一些逻辑电路,甚至小型CPU,那么恭喜你,你可以完全抛弃ARM,投入FPGA或ASIC的怀抱,做一名IC设计工程师。
温馨提示:内容为网友见解,仅供参考
第1个回答  2010-04-07
首先,ARM可以分为硬件和软件两方面,软件又分应用和驱动,你要是想学硬件,就要有些模数电的基础,会用一种绘图软件绘制原理图和PCB,会用ADS或别的调试硬件,在底层,没有OS的情况下,这个周期下来要几个月吧,要学会做笔记,把出现的问题都记下来,以便以后查询。
其次,软件方面,看你的需求,是想学应用还是驱动,应用基本上是C在Linux下的编程。驱动就要看看Linux内核了,其实学习Linux的最好办法就是读Linux内核。
再次,Linux的知识体系很庞大,很杂,要自己有个条理来学,还是要有任务来学,要是工作了就是有项目来用来学,要是上学,就自己想把他用在什么方面再去学,就是带着问题去学,会很快的。
2440的资料网上有的是,只要一搜就出来很大一堆,这个倒不难找。

mini2440的产品概述
Mini2440是一款真正低价实用的ARM9开发板,是目前国内性价比最高的一款学习板;它采用Samsung S3C2440为微处理器,并采用专业稳定的CPU内核电源芯片和复位芯片来保证系统运行时的稳定性。mini2440的PCB采用沉金工艺的四层板设计,专业等长布线,保证关键信号线的信号完整性,生产采用机器贴片,批量生产;出厂时...

请了解友善之臂的mini2440开发板的高手给点意见~
主流的s3c2440A处理器,arm9内核 接口齐全,文档也比较丰富.利用板载资源可以学习不少东西.完整的嵌入式wince和linux都可以开发.还可以移植其它系统,当然这方面用的就少了.目前来看是做学习板较好的厂商.售后没接触过,因为我还没遇到什么问题需要联系售后的.有专门的交流论坛.烧程序需要串口,jtag调试需要并...

mini2440开发板可以用来学习嵌入式Linux开发吗?
首先不太清楚你用的MINI2440是什么样子,2440开发板我到是有,如果你使用的是2440开发板,此开发板因该分为核心板和外设板两部分,使用的是ARM9处理器,有网络、声音等模块,这样的话是可以作为开发板学习嵌入式开发,建议现吧开发板的基础了解的清楚些,比如每个芯片的模块和想对应的LINUX的内核模块的...

arm9mini2440菜鸟问题。
1.如果编译没有问题的话,在开发板上库健全,或编译时不生成库,或你把生成的lib文件已经放置在开发板上且有环境变量的话。在你编译内核版本\/编译内核使用的工具与你交叉编译链版本差距不大的话,应该能直接运行。(当然还有驱动要匹配)简单说,小软件一般没什么问题能直接运行,大软件一般不出问题才...

请教一下ARM高手 我想用mini2440 ARM9开发板开发图形用户界面 wince和li...
建议用linux。linux下的QT很好用,QT是纯正的C++,学起来要比VC容易,跨平台与通用性也高。linux支持的厂家多,代码执行效率比wince的高。

想买个ARM嵌入式开发板,看中了两款,大家帮我看看哪个更好啊,更适合学习...
4)mini2440没有qq这样的即时性技术支持,要发电子邮件。tq2440有qq技术支持 两款板都可以到淘宝网购买:tq2440+3.5寸液晶 580元。这个是送usb转串口线的,对于没有串口的电脑来说,是必备的,省去了自己花钱。这个线市面上是需要30元左右。http:\/\/item.taobao.com\/auction\/item_detail-0db1-...

ARM2440是什么意思ARM2440开发板是什么
此外,友善之臂还提供了丰富的开发板资源,包括文档、示例代码等,可以帮助开发者更好地掌握嵌入式系统的开发技巧。如果你需要进一步了解嵌入式系统或ARM2440芯片的相关信息,可以参考这些资源。总的来说,ARM2440是一款功能强大的嵌入式芯片,mini2440开发板则为开发者提供了便捷的开发工具。对于想要学习嵌入...

2440开发板2440开发板分类概述
Mini2440作为一款经济实用的ARM9开发板,以Samsung S3C2440为核心,具备稳定的CPU电源和复位芯片,采用沉金四层板设计,保证信号完整性。其易于学习,C语言基础者两周内即可入门,是国内性价比极高的学习板。FL2440在基础功能上更进一步,配备了256M nandflash、四USB主口、红外接口和温度传感器接口等扩展...

本人最近要买ARM开发板,有些顾虑和疑问。
1、买开发板是根据需求来买的,从用途上讲:如果仅仅是用做控制ARM7足够了;如果是用做低分辨率(小于等于320*240)的视频采集、传输,ARM9可以凑合用,ARM11要稍微好些;如果是需要高分辨率的话,用A8、A9比较适合。2、如果是学习的话,我个人认为选择ARM9作为入门比较好。因为,第一,ARM9比ARM7...

现在刚学开发,请问哪款的开发板适合初学者?
推荐ARM mini2440, 友善之臂的那款, 很适合初学者使用.有大量的教程和资料.在淘宝上有卖的, 我买过一款, 连光盘都佩带了, 是带教学的整个一套,价格在500左右.可惜我买回来就没用过, 后来做应用层开发了.如果兄弟想学嵌入式软件开发, 兴趣和坚持是缺一不可的, 一定要耐得住寂寞, 潜心钻研,吃...

相似回答
大家正在搜